Body

Founding

Founders include Walter Hagemann[5], Erich Feldmann[6], and Martin Keilhacker[7]. +1953-00-00T00:00:00Z marks the founding of Deutsche Gesellschaft für Kommunikationsforschung[21].

Identity

Deutsche Gesellschaft für Kommunikationsforschung's official name is recorded as it[27]. Its short name is recorded as DGKF[28].

Leadership

Chairpersons include Alphons Silbermann[18], a musicologist[29], 1909–2000[30], of Germany[31], awarded the Commander's Cross of the Order of Merit of the Federal Republic of Germany[32]; Walter Nutz[19], a journalist[33], 1924–2000[34], specialised in sociology of literature[35]; and Erwin Scheuch[20], a sociologist[36], 1928–2003[37], of Germany[38], awarded the Officer's Cross of the Order of Merit of the Federal Republic of Germany[39], specialised in sociology[40].

Operations

Deutsche Gesellschaft für Kommunikationsforschung's headquarters location is recorded as Cologne[8].

Industry

Deutsche Gesellschaft für Kommunikationsforschung's industry is recorded as higher education[16]. Its field of work was communication science[2].
